    Hey EmilyEliza,
    As you are clearly aware, it is important for you to have backups of your important data, including all of these photos you are currently keeping on your iPhone. While it is possible to use iTunes or iCloud to do backups of your iPhone, the problem becomes how to access those backups if you have deleted the photos from your iPhone. Once you have done the backup and then removed the photos from the iPhone, the only way to access the photos is by restoring the backups to the phone. See this article for information about backups made from the iPhone -
    Back up and restore your i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ch using iCloud or iTunes - Apple Support
    If you want to easily access the photos once they are off of the iPhone, another approach to this would be to import your photos from the iPhone into an application on your Mac, such as iPhoto. To learn how to do this, use the steps in this article -
    Import photos and videos from your iPhone, iPad, or iPod touch to your Mac or Windows PC - Apple Support
    Once those photos are on your computer, it is still important to back up those photos to somewhere else, so you can be sure of their safety before removing them from the iPhone. Your Mac’s Time Machine application is one method of doing this -
    Mac Basics: Time Machine backs up your Mac - Apple Support

    Mechanist wrote:
    At some point I told Time Machine to get rid of backups of a particular file using the "Delete all backups of ..." option. Time Machine duly deleted the backups of the file and stopped making new ones.
    Not exactly.  It did delete the existing backups, but didn't make any new ones because the file hasn't changed since then.
    The easiest way to get it to back it up is to make a minor change to it (the name or something in the contents), then change it back.  Time Machine should back it up on the next backup.
    Alternatively, you need to force a "deep scan," where Time Machine compares everything on your system to the backups.  Usually, just starting up from your Recovery HD will do that, although sometimes you have to start from it and Repair your internal HD to trigger it. 
    If you're not sure how to do that, see Using the Recovery HD and/or #6 in Using Disk Utility.
